Your browser does not support javascript! Please enable it, otherwise web will not work for you.

Senior Software Engineer - Infrastructure @ Nvidia

Home > Programming & Design

 Senior Software Engineer - Infrastructure

Job Description

What you'll be doing:

  • You will design creative scalable cloud solutions to scale to millions of jobs and thousands of systems.

  • You will be working on challenging problems in area of infrastructure such as job scheduling, resource management and automated recovery.
  • Develop various device plugins on Kubernetes.
  • Build complete solutions including Metrics, Alert and Storage Services.
  • You want to dig more data, analyze much more, deep learning algorithms / machine learn to improve the performance/predictability of the system.

What we need to see:

  • Strong object - oriented programming background in Java.

  • Experience of developing large scale cloud infrastructure applications.
  • Knowledge of various technologies (Kubernetes, Kafka, Jenkins).
  • Experience with Containers (Docker, Kubernetes) Web Services (SOAP/REST) and Scalable Storage(HDFS/Ceph) and Jenkins.
  • Experience with Relational Databases such as MySQL, NoSQL DBs such as Elastic Search, MongoDB, HBase.
  • Ability to collaborate across multiple team and across people working in different time zones.
  • BS/MS in Computer Science or Computer Engineering.
  • 8+ years of industry experience.

Ways to stand out from the crowd:

  • You have worked on computer algorithms and demonstrated ability to choose the best possible algorithms to nail complex problems.

  • You are able to divide complex problems into simple sub problems and then reuse available solutions to implement the solutions.
  • Experience in design, implementation and deployment of major infrastructure features across multiple servers in incremental roll - out mode.
  • Experience with Machine Learning and Data Analytics and application of them in Infrastructure
  • Ability to design simple systems that can work well with minimal operational support.

NVIDIA is widely considered to be one of the technology world s most desirable employers. We have some of the most brilliant and talented people in the world working for us. If you're creative and passionate about developing cloud services we want to hear from you!

We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.

Job Classification

Industry: IT-Hardware & Networking
Functional Area: IT Software - Application Programming, Maintenance,
Role Category: Programming & Design
Role: Programming & Design
Employement Type: Full time

Education

Under Graduation: Any Graduate in Any Specialization
Post Graduation: Post Graduation Not Required
Doctorate: Doctorate Not Required, Any Doctorate in Any Specialization

Contact Details:

Company: Nvidia Corporation
Location(s): Pune

+ View Contactajax loader


Keyskills:   Graphics Computer science Linux MySQL X86 Machine learning Scheduling Windows Resource management Android

 Job seems aged, it may have been expired!
 Fraud Alert to job seekers!

₹ Not Disclosed

Nvidia

Nvidia Corporation